TO cater to companies that often send their executives out on trips to Asia and beyond, British Airways has introduced the On Business rewards program, an opportunity for businesses to gain reciprocal benefits.
Much like the Executive Club frequent flyer program, the On Business program allows companies to register and earn rewards as a collective entity.
One of the advantages of the rewards scheme is the allowance for “double dipping” air miles. This means that if an employee is sent out on a trip, both the company account and the employee’s personal account are eligible to claim rewards.
For those who are self-employed, this presents the opportunity to double up on air miles on one trip.
If your company prefers to take advantage of discounts rather than rake up air miles, the program gives businesses the liberty to choose between a price cut and a point collection system.
To sign up for the program, UK businesses are required to present evidence of their company being registered by VAT, while Australian companies must produce their ABN numbers.
The registering process can be done online within minutes.
